The Ledgerline billing worker ships via blue-green deploys, and plugin authors should understand the implications carefully. During cutover, both color stacks may briefly process events, so your plugin must tolerate duplicate delivery and must never assume exclusive ownership of an invoice. Schema migrations are applied before the green stack warms, meaning your plugin should read-tolerate the newer schema one release early. The complete deploy lifecycle, timing diagram, and compatibility checklist are published on the internal page below.

wiki page, bagaf-fawip: https://harbor.tolvaqsys.local/pages/repo/pages/secrets/eac969ffc71f356b

Hey Marisol — handing off the wiki role-based access work before I'm out. The Pinewick wiki now has three tiers: viewer, contributor, and steward. Stewards can edit permission groups; everyone else can't, which fixed the mess from last sprint. One gotcha: cached sessions keep stale roles for up to an hour. Everything else is in the migration notes I wrote up on the internal page below.

wiki page, hahif-hahif: https://argocd.kelvisys.corp/browse/board/settings/pages/1442e0b1065d83f1

Subject: Handover — reset flow revamp

Hey Marisol,

Wrapping up my shift. The password reset revamp on Pondglass shipped to staging tonight. Heads-up for plugin folks: the old reset-token hook is deprecated, and plugins must migrate to the new onResetRequested event before the next release. Docs are updated in the plugin portal under Auth Changes. One flaky e2e test remains (reset-email timing); I've quarantined it. If plugin authors hit migration snags overnight, point them to the integrations desk at the address below.

pager mailbox: silael.sorwyn.tamius@zemvarsys.corp

Ticket: StockTally reconciliation job failing — expired credential

The nightly inventory reconciliation job for the Halverd warehouse feed has failed since Monday. Cause: the service credential for the internal StockTally API expired at its 90-day boundary; no renewal automation exists for this account. No evidence of misuse in the audit logs. Remediation: credential rotated, job re-run successfully, and automated rotation ticketed. For the reviewer's records, the replacement key issued for the job is below.

gateway credential: vxb4-QTMv